首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Nuxt Axios post到Laravel API的多个参数

Nuxt是一个基于Vue.js的通用应用框架,它可以帮助我们快速构建服务器渲染的Vue.js应用程序。Axios是一个基于Promise的HTTP客户端,用于发送HTTP请求。Laravel是一个流行的PHP框架,用于构建Web应用程序和API。

当我们需要使用Nuxt向Laravel API发送多个参数时,可以使用Axios的post方法。下面是一个示例代码:

代码语言:txt
复制
// 在Nuxt中发送post请求到Laravel API
async fetchData() {
  try {
    const response = await this.$axios.post('/api/endpoint', {
      param1: 'value1',
      param2: 'value2',
      param3: 'value3'
    });
    console.log(response.data);
  } catch (error) {
    console.error(error);
  }
}

在上面的代码中,我们使用了Nuxt中的$axios对象来发送post请求。我们将API的URL设置为/api/endpoint,并通过传递一个包含多个参数的对象来发送数据。

在Laravel API中,我们可以通过请求对象来获取这些参数。下面是一个简单的Laravel API示例代码:

代码语言:txt
复制
// 在Laravel API中接收post请求
public function endpoint(Request $request)
{
    $param1 = $request->input('param1');
    $param2 = $request->input('param2');
    $param3 = $request->input('param3');

    // 处理参数并返回响应
    // ...

    return response()->json(['message' => 'Success']);
}

在上面的代码中,我们使用了Laravel的Request对象来获取post请求中的参数。通过调用input方法并传递参数名称,我们可以获取到对应的参数值。

至于Nuxt、Axios、Laravel的优势、应用场景以及腾讯云相关产品和产品介绍链接地址,由于要求不能提及特定的云计算品牌商,我无法提供具体的信息。但是,Nuxt、Axios和Laravel都是非常流行和广泛使用的工具和框架,它们在前端开发、后端开发和API构建方面都有很好的表现。你可以通过搜索引擎或官方文档来了解它们的详细信息和相关的腾讯云产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分6秒

09_尚硅谷_axios从入门到源码分析_ajax封装_post请求携带参数数据

18分8秒

06_尚硅谷_axios从入门到源码分析_XHR的API

2分7秒

基于深度强化学习的机械臂位置感知抓取任务

1分30秒

基于强化学习协助机器人系统在多个操纵器之间负载均衡。

领券